How much do assistant controller j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for assistant controller in Virginia is $101,560.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$82,800.00 and $118,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Assistant Controllers?

Assistant Controllers are finance professionals who support the Controller in managing an organization's accounting operations. Their responsibilities typically include overseeing daily accounting functions, preparing financial statements, ensuring compliance with regulations, and assisting with budgeting and audits. They often supervise accounting staff and help implement internal controls to safeguard company assets. Assistant Controllers play a critical role in maintaining accurate financial records and supporting strategic financial planning.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Assistant Controller,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Controller, you need a solid background in accounting principles, financial reporting, and typically a bachelor's degree in accounting or finance, with a CPA or similar certification often preferred. Proficiency in ERP systems like SAP or Oracle, as well as advanced Excel skills, is commonly required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ication are standout so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ure accurate financial management, regulatory compliance, and effective support for organizational decision-making.

What Is an Assistant Controller?

Assistant controllers are financial professionals who assist the controller in the accounting department of a company or organization. Responsibilities of an assistant controller include working with the controller on the preparation of financial statements, participating in annual audits, managing invoices, meeting industry guidelines, and following state and federal accounting laws. Assistant controllers’ duties include reconciling accounts on a quarterly basis, and they must have skills in developing financial reports for forecasting and reporting. Assistant controllers are generally not required to have their CPA designation.

How does an Assistant Controller typ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

As an Assistant Controller, you will regularly partner with departments such as operations, sales, and human resources to ensure financial data accuracy, support budgeting efforts, and provide financial insights for decision-making. This collaboration often involves coordinating monthly close processes, reviewing departmental budgets, and assisting with internal audits. Building strong relationships with colleagues across functions is key, as it helps streamline workflows, resolve issues quickly, and contribute to overall organizational effectiveness.

What is the difference between Assistant Controller vs Controller?

AspectAssistant ControllerController
CredentialsBachelor's degree in accounting or finance; CPA often preferredBachelor's degree; CPA or CMA typically required; extensive experience
Work EnvironmentSupports accounting team; reports to Controller; involved in daily financial operationsOversees entire accounting department; responsible for financial reporting and compliance
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in corporate finance, manufacturing, and large organizationsSenior finance role in similar industries, often with strategic responsibilities

The Assistant Controller assists the Controller in managing daily accounting functions and financial reporting, often focusing on specific areas like accounts payable or payroll. The Controller holds a higher-level position, overseeing the entire accounting department, ensuring accurate financial statements, and maintaining compliance. While both roles require similar credentials, the Controller has broader responsibilities and strategic oversight.
